Foundations Help Sarasota High Schools Get ‘Innovative’
Published: Sarasota County Schools unveiled six redesigned ILA classrooms created and implemented through a partnership with Ringling College of Art and Design, Charles & Margery Barancik Foundation, and Gulf Coast Community Foundation. The innovative classrooms are part of a larger effort to transform the learning experience for ILA students by improving content delivery, student engagement, and teacher retention.Gulf Coast Community Foundation Hosts Board Institute Reunion
